Mysql 基础知识
类型:
1.数值类型:
tinyitn -128,127 小整数值;
smallint -32768,32767 大整数值;
mediumint -8388608,8388607 大整数值;
int -2147483648,2147483647;
bigint -923372036854775808,923372036854775807 极大整数值;
2.小数类型:
float 单精度;
double 双精度;
时间类型
date YYYY-MM-DD
datetime YYYY-MM-DD HH:mm:SS
time HH:MM:SS
字符串类型
char
varchar
text
sql语句:
插入数据:
1、插入数据:
>INSERT INTO tb_name(id,name,score)VALUES(NULL,'张三',140),(NULL,'张四',178),(NULL,'张五',134);
这里的插入多条数据直接在后边加上逗号,直接写入插入的数据即可;主键id是自增的列,可以不用写。
2、插入检索出来的数据:
>INSERT INTO tb_name(name,score) SELECT name,score FROM tb_name2;
更新数据:
1、指定更新数据:
>UPDATE tb_name SET score=189 WHERE id=2;
>UPDATE tablename SET columnName=NewValue [ WHERE condition ]
删除数据:
1、删除数据:
>DELETE FROM tb_name WHERE id=3;
条件控制:
1、WHERE 语句:
>SELECT * FROM tb_name WHERE id=3;
2、HAVING 语句:
>SELECT * FROM tb_name GROUP BY score HAVING count(*)>2
转载于:https://www.cnblogs.com/5aiQ/p/7455498.html
Mysql 基础知识相关推荐
- MySQL工作中的实际用_总结工作中经常用到的mysql基础知识
总结工作中经常用到的mysql基础知识 发布时间:2020-06-08 11:27:30 来源:51CTO 阅读:217 作者:三月 本文主要给大家介绍工作中经常用到的mysql基础知识,文章内容都是 ...
- mysql基础知识(二)
这一篇是第二部分,要查看第一部分,请查看这个链接 mysql基础知识(一) DQL语言 1.1简单的单表查询 查询表的通用格式:select [distinct] [*] [列名1,列名] from ...
- mysql基础知识(一)
mysql是主流的关系型数据库管理系统(RDBMS---relation database management system),操作是需要用SQL(Structured Query Language ...
- MySQL基础知识-MySQL概述安装,单表增删改查,函数,约束,多表查询,事物
MySQL基础知识-MySQL概述安装,单表增删改查,函数,约束,多表查询,事物 前言 1.MySQL概述 1.1数据库相关概念 1.2MySQL数据库 1.2.1版本 1.2.2下载 1.2.3安装 ...
- 【MySQL基础知识】查询、过滤数据关键字
MySQL基础知识 一.检索数据 1. SELECT select是使用最广泛的检索数据的语句. 检索要查的表的所有列: select * from (表名称)... 检索要查的表的某一列或多列: s ...
- 快速学习mysql_快速学习MySQL基础知识
这篇文章主要梳理了 SQL 的基础用法,会涉及到以下方面内容: SQL大小写的规范 数据库的类型以及适用场景 SELECT 的执行过程 WHERE 使用规范 MySQL 中常见函数 子查询分类 如何选 ...
- MySQL基础知识之增删改查
MySQL基础知识之增删改查 MySQL基本语法: 1.创建库:create database 库名: 创建带编码格式的库:create database 库名 character set 编码格式: ...
- linux增删查改语句,mysql基础知识之增删查改使用介绍
mysql基础知识之增删查改使用介绍 本文主要介绍mysql常用的SELECT.INSERT.UPDATE.DELETE语句的使用,数据库的安装这里不做介绍,并且事先已经准备好相关数据. 本文中使用的 ...
- MySql基础知识【一】
Mysql基础知识 1. MySql是什么 2. 数据库设计的三大范式 2.1. 第一范式 2.2. 第二范式 2.3. 第三范式 3. Binlog的三种模式 3.1 Statement模式(默认) ...
- 2.MySQL 基础知识
文章目录 MySQL 基础知识 知识点一 : MySQL命令行常用命令 知识点二 : 持久化 相关概念 知识点三 : 数据库 相关概念 知识点四 : DB 和 DBMS 关系图示 知识点五 : MyS ...
最新文章
- 硕士全年不开学?一批高校发布秋季学期返校时间!
- Linux网络编程——tcp并发服务器(epoll实现)
- 不允许输入特殊字符的正则表达式_JavaScript正则表达式常用技巧
- 活动推荐|互联网3.0与区块链新时代论坛(北京)
- SSAS系列——【05】多维数据(编程体系结构)
- iphone悬浮球怎么设置_OPPO手机怎么截屏?大部分的人只会两种,包括你吗?
- 疑似OPPO Reno6系列新机通过工信部认证:配备6.43英寸屏 机身仅7.9mm
- 加州将放宽无人车路测标准:没方向盘也行,没人类驾驶员也行
- Tinder活号技术在YouTube上面居然有用模拟器和浏览器玩明白了使用谷歌下载的
- office2007打开word提示《向程序发送命令时出现问题》
- IT人的5G网络架构视点:从网络架构演进的前世今生详解5G各NF网络功能体
- Qt中去掉空格和回车(两行代码)
- 为什么我们选择LambdaMART作为我们的酒店排序模型
- 艺赛旗(RPA)Python:遍历输出某路径下的所有文件和文件夹
- 吴裕雄--天生自然 高等数学学习:导数的几何意义
- 解决vscode打开中文乱码,用记事本打开却无乱码
- 《实用技巧》网页保存方式(完整保存)总结
- UVA-12627 Erratic Expansion
- java中this和super是否可以同时使用
- android测试环境搭建